I have a .max file that I need to convert to either .3ds or . obj and I dont have or use 3d studio max. Is there a way to convert it without using max, or can someone help me make the conversion?

me and jeff cannot open it because its done in a highter verison of max you cannot open a higher verison of max in a lower verison
